
Ahmed Muslimani
Ahmed Muslimani is an Egyptian writer and media figure, currently serving as the head of the National Media Authority. He is known for his work in promoting Egyptian culture and heritage through various media platforms, and recently announced a new programming schedule for the Quran Radio during Ramadan.
